Scope that changes the quote
Use these buckets so a flooring quote is not reduced to one vague square-foot number.
Floating installation
Most laminate uses a click system, but time changes with cuts, closets, hallways, and transitions.
Flatness
Laminate needs a flat, stable subfloor; leveling or repairs should be quoted separately.
Underlayment
Attached pad, separate underlayment, moisture barrier, and manufacturer requirements can change material and labor.
Finish work
Trim, quarter round, doors, stairs, and height changes should be confirmed before comparing prices.

Removal, disposal, and practical job rules
These details often explain why two quotes with the same square footage do not end up the same.
Permit notes
Standard flooring replacement in El Paso, TX usually does not require a permit, but permits can come into play when the project includes structural, electrical, or plumbing work.
Removal and disposal
El Paso residents can dispose of flooring like tile, hardwood, carpet, and vinyl through regular trash collection if they fit within the standard trash cart and do not exceed weight limits. For larger quantities or bulky items, residents should utilize the city's bulk waste pickup service, which has specific guidelines for acceptable and scheduling.

Laminate flooring labor FAQ
How is laminate flooring installation cost estimated?
Start with square footage and local labor, then add removal, underlayment, transitions, trim, stairs, and subfloor prep when they apply.
Does laminate need subfloor prep?
Yes. Laminate needs a flat, clean, stable surface, and product tolerances can affect how much prep is required.
Does this include laminate material?
No. The calculator focuses on labor and scope so material, waste, underlayment, delivery, and store pricing can be compared separately.
When should I ask for a walkthrough?
Ask before committing when there is old flooring to remove, uneven subfloor, moisture concern, stairs, heavy furniture, or many transitions.

Does a flooring contractor need to be licensed to work on my El Paso home?
Texas does not require a state-level contractor license for flooring installation work. The city requires flooring contractor registration. The specific department or system for this registration is not specified in the provided source.
Is flooring installation labor taxable in Texas?
Labor separately stated is not taxable. Flooring materials sold are taxable.
Are delivery fees taxable in Texas?
Local delivery is taxable.
